How to Fix Dental Emergencies in Ocoee
Dental emergencies are stressful, but staying calm and acting quickly makes all the difference. The good news? Emergency dentistry in Ocoee is available for same-day appointments so you can get relief fast. Here's a simple step-by-step process for handling the most common emergencies:
- Call your dentist immediately. Don't wait and hope it gets better. Call us at (407) 378-3704 to get seen as quickly as possible.
- Manage pain at home. Over-the-counter pain relievers and cold compresses can help while you wait for your appointment.
- Protect a knocked-out tooth. Keep it moist — store it in milk or hold it between your cheek and gum — and get to a dentist within an hour.
- Save broken pieces. If a tooth chips or cracks, bring any fragments to your appointment.
- Avoid pressure on the area. Don't chew on the affected side until you've been evaluated.
At your emergency visit, the dental team will evaluate your situation, manage your pain, and recommend the right treatment — whether that's a root canal, extraction, or temporary restoration. You'll also receive post-care instructions to protect your smile while it heals.

Restorative Treatments That Fix Damaged Teeth
Many dental issues fall under the category of restorative dentistry. This means rebuilding or repairing teeth that have been damaged by decay, trauma, or wear. The goal is simple: restore function and appearance so your smile feels healthy again. Here are the most popular restorative solutions:
- Crowns and bridges — Custom caps that protect damaged teeth and replace missing ones
- Dental implants — Permanent tooth replacement that looks and feels completely natural
- Dentures — A full or partial solution for multiple missing teeth
- Fillings — Treat cavities and restore the structure of decayed teeth

Preventive Care That Stops Dental Issues Before They Start
The best way to fix dental issues in Ocoee? Prevent them from happening in the first place. Preventive care is simple, affordable, and incredibly effective. Here's what a solid preventive routine looks like:
- Twice-yearly cleanings and exams — Catch small problems before they grow
- Daily brushing and flossing — Remove plaque that causes decay and gum disease
- Fluoride treatments and sealants — Extra protection for kids and adults alike
- Oral cancer screenings — A quick check that can be life-saving
- Gum disease monitoring — Catch early signs of periodontal disease before it worsens

Q: What should I do if I knock out a tooth in Ocoee?
A: Act fast! Keep the tooth moist by placing it in milk or between your cheek and gum, and get to a dentist within 30 to 60 minutes for the best chance of saving it. Call your dentist immediately — time really is the most important factor in this situation.
